黑狐家游戏

非关系型数据库作用,非关系型数据库是一种什么的二叉树形式

欧气 2 0

非关系型数据库:超越二叉树的强大数据存储与管理

本文深入探讨了非关系型数据库的本质、特点及其与传统关系型数据库的区别,详细阐述了非关系型数据库如何以独特的方式存储和管理数据,以及它在处理大规模、高并发、非结构化数据等场景下的卓越优势,通过对非关系型数据库多种类型的介绍,展示了其在当今数字化时代的重要地位和广泛应用。

一、引言

在当今数字化的浪潮中,数据的数量和复杂性呈爆炸式增长,传统的关系型数据库在处理大规模、高并发、非结构化数据时逐渐显露出一些局限性,为了应对这些挑战,非关系型数据库应运而生,成为数据存储与管理领域的重要力量。

二、非关系型数据库的定义与特点

非关系型数据库,也被称为 NoSQL 数据库,是一种不同于传统关系型数据库的新型数据存储方式,它具有以下显著特点:

1、灵活的数据模型:非关系型数据库不遵循严格的表结构和关系定义,允许数据以更自由的方式存储和组织,这使得它能够轻松应对复杂多变的数据结构,更好地适应不同类型的数据需求。

2、高可扩展性:通过分布式架构和水平扩展的方式,非关系型数据库可以轻松应对不断增长的数据量和访问量,提供强大的性能和可用性。

3、高性能:由于其独特的数据存储和检索机制,非关系型数据库在处理大规模数据时能够提供极高的读写性能,满足实时性要求较高的应用场景。

4、弱一致性:与关系型数据库的强一致性要求不同,非关系型数据库通常采用最终一致性的策略,在保证数据可靠性的同时,提高了系统的可用性和性能。

三、非关系型数据库的类型

目前,市场上主要有以下几种非关系型数据库类型:

1、键值存储数据库:以键值对的形式存储数据,简单高效,适用于缓存、配置信息等场景。

2、文档数据库:将数据存储为文档的形式,类似于 JSON 格式,适合存储半结构化或非结构化数据,如博客文章、用户资料等。

3、列族数据库:将数据按照列族进行存储,适合存储大规模的稀疏数据,如日志数据、物联网数据等。

4、图形数据库:以图形的方式表示数据之间的关系,适用于社交网络、推荐系统等领域。

四、非关系型数据库的优势

1、处理大规模数据:非关系型数据库能够轻松处理 PB 级甚至 EB 级的数据量,满足互联网企业、金融机构等对大规模数据存储和分析的需求。

2、高并发访问:通过分布式架构和缓存机制,非关系型数据库可以支持高并发的读写请求,确保系统的性能和可用性。

3、灵活的数据模型:非关系型数据库的灵活数据模型使得它能够快速适应业务需求的变化,减少数据迁移和重构的成本。

4、支持非结构化数据:对于图像、视频、音频等非结构化数据,非关系型数据库提供了更好的存储和处理方式,能够充分发挥其优势。

5、高可用性:通过副本机制和分布式存储,非关系型数据库可以提供高可用性,确保数据的可靠性和安全性。

五、非关系型数据库的应用场景

非关系型数据库在以下领域得到了广泛的应用:

1、互联网企业:如社交媒体、电子商务、在线游戏等,需要处理大规模的用户数据和高并发的请求。

2、金融机构:用于存储交易数据、客户信息等,需要保证数据的安全性和可靠性。

3、物联网:处理海量的传感器数据,需要高效的存储和检索机制。

4、大数据分析:为大数据分析提供数据存储和处理平台,支持复杂的数据分析和挖掘任务。

5、内容管理系统:如新闻网站、博客平台等,需要存储和管理大量的文本、图片、视频等内容。

六、非关系型数据库的发展趋势

随着技术的不断发展,非关系型数据库也在不断演进和创新,非关系型数据库的发展趋势主要包括以下几个方面:

1、云原生:越来越多的非关系型数据库将向云原生方向发展,提供更加便捷的部署和管理方式,降低用户的使用成本。

2、多模数据存储:支持多种数据模型的融合,满足不同类型数据的存储和管理需求。

3、人工智能与机器学习集成:与人工智能和机器学习技术深度融合,提供更强大的数据处理和分析能力。

4、实时性和流处理:加强对实时数据的处理和流处理能力,满足实时应用场景的需求。

5、安全与隐私保护:更加注重数据的安全和隐私保护,提供更加可靠的安全机制。

七、结论

非关系型数据库作为一种新兴的数据存储和管理技术,具有灵活的数据模型、高可扩展性、高性能、弱一致性等特点,在处理大规模、高并发、非结构化数据等场景下具有卓越的优势,随着技术的不断发展,非关系型数据库将在更多领域得到广泛应用,并不断演进和创新,为数字化时代的数据存储和管理提供更加强大的支持。

标签: #非关系型数据库 #作用 #二叉树 #形式

黑狐家游戏
  • 评论列表

留言评论